I am running the newest version of xine/xine-lib/libdvdcss and am experiencing
a problem where DVD playback freezes 1/2 to 2/3 of the way through the disk.  

Everything about the playback goes flawlessly up until the point it freezes,
sometimes I notice that the playback (and additional attempts to play after
this happens) just get exceedingly slow and choppy.  Some disks do not have
this problem, and there have been circumstances where I can get through the
problem disk without freezes.

xine-check comes up clean, I notice a few Suspected RCE Region Protection!!!
notices on the terminal prior to the freeze up.

I'm running MythTV 0.18.1 on FC2.  I have tried the following xine command
line options:

xine -pfhq --no-splash dvd://
xine -f -I -V xshm --audo-driver alsa --no-logo --no-splash dvd://

Both options experience the same problem.  Everything else about my
installation works perfectly.

Is there any other options to try?  Could this possibly be caused by a bad DVD
drive?  If so, could anyone recommend one that has been proven to make it
through a whole movie?
